Vademecum controls for companies in the agri-food sector 2025 MASAF has published the Operational Plan for Controls in the Agri-food Sector 2025 (Poc 2025) together with the new "Vademecum for Controls for Companies in the Agri-food Sector" .

The Poc 2025 defines the control activities envisaged to counter these risks, including controls on labelling, traceability, fraud on the Community budget and animal welfare.

In addition to confirming the sectors of intervention already identified in 2024 - such as wine, oil, dairy, fruit and vegetables, cereals and derivatives, fish, meat, honey, animal feed, in addition to the fight against community fraud - significant innovations are also introduced.

In particular, the animal welfare sector has been included among the priorities, with specific checks entrusted to the forestry police and the NAS.

Furthermore, new risk factors will be introduced to protect the sector of buffalo milk produced daily for the production of Mozzarella di Bufala Campana DOP.

In the fruit and vegetable sector, controls will be intensified, with particular attention to seasonality and imports, to ensure the correct indication of the origin of the products.

Finally, the last section of the document provides a Vademecum for companies , defining types of general controls :
  • labeling,
  • traceability,
  • unfair commercial practices;
and sectoral controls : wine, oil, dairy, fruit and vegetables, cereals, meat, honey, animal feed, BIO, DOP and IGP, fish, animal welfare (for livestock), with an indication of the relative sanctioning provisions applied in the event of any violations found. (Source: https://www.arsedizioni.it/ )
